Master Electrician salary in Qatar

Average Yearly Salary of Master Electrician in Qatar is approximately 346,033 QAR (86,964 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. What does Master Electrician do?

occupation personasA master electrician is a highly skilled and experienced professional responsible for overseeing electrical projects, ensuring their safety, functionality, and compliance with regulations. They are involved in the design, installation, maintenance, and repair of electrical systems in various settings such as residential, commercial, and industrial buildings. Master electricians possess extensive knowledge of electrical codes and blueprints, allowing them to plan and execute complex electrical installations. They supervise a team of electricians, ensuring that work is carried out efficiently and to high standards. Additionally, they troubleshoot electrical issues, diagnose problems, and provide appropriate solutions. Safety is a top priority for master electricians, as they implement measures to prevent electrical hazards and ensure compliance with safety protocols. With their expertise, they contribute to the smooth functioning of electrical systems, enabling efficient power distribution.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ary.
